Research on the properties of Ti-Pd alloy layer prepared by the glow plasma surface metallurgy of Ti

Ti-Pd alloy layer has been prepared on the pure Ti surface by the glow plasma metallurgy technology. A gradient current of Pds content was observed in the alloy layer. Furthermore,five kinds of compound (TiPd3、TiPd2、Ti2Pd3、Ti3Pd5、Ti4Pd) and Pd appeared. The Corrosion resistant to crack of the alloy in the NaCl saturated solution with the temperature and 8.6% H2SO4 solution with the temperature at 40癈 is better than that of Ti0.2Pd alloy;at room temperature,while the alloy was put into 80%H2OS4 solution,the corrosion rate is just 0.682mm/a,which is 18.2% of that for Ti0.2Pd alloy;Also,when it was immerged in the 30% HC1 solution at the same temperature,the rate is only 0.004mm/a,which is just 12.5% of Ti0.2Pd alloy.
